Conditions You May Face After Car Accident

Seeking medical attention is in your immediate best interest; you may be entitled to compensation and justice down the road.

  • Lacerations 

Lacerations can cause injuries like minor scrapes or cuts to more serious wounds called degloving injuries. A skin graft involves the removal of the skin, leaving the underlying tissue exposed. Injuries of this type usually require surgical intervention and require a prolonged recovery period. Scars and functional impairments are often permanent reminders of the accident.

  • Whiplash

The most common injury from an accident is whiplash, which may occur in minor or severe crashes, particularly when there is an unexpected impact, such as in a rear-end collision. When you are struck by another vehicle, your head is jerked backward as a result of the impact force. 

Muscles and tendons in the upper back and neck are stressed as a result of the sudden forward-backward movement. Several symptoms may occur following an accident, including neck pain, blurred vision, tingling, headaches, or generalized back pain.

  • Burns

The device used to deploy the airbag may cause burns following its deployment. Because of your seat belt locking you into place may also lead to friction burns. Immediately, go to the emergency room, if you suffer from burns.

  • Fractures

When a serious, high-speed impact occurs, fractures may occur. As the car absorbs the impact, it will be distorted by the impact force. 

  • Internal Bleeding

Fractures in car accidents often result in internal bleeding, which is a sign of serious injury. Leaving internal bleeding untreated even for a short time can result in the loss of limbs or vital organs, as well as death in the most serious cases.Should you suspect that you or someone else has internal damage, you should contact the emergency services immediately.

  • Numb or tingling Sensations

A collision may result in numbness, pain, or tingling in your hands, back, neck, and other extremities.  After a car accident, they will provide treatment and discuss other physical symptoms you may experience.

  • Tinnitus

After a collision, you may experience earrings which may be indicative of tinnitus. Despite the fact that tinnitus may not appear to be a classic physical symptom resulting from a car accident, it may indicate an underlying health problem.

When it is Necessary to See a Doctor After a Car Accident

Often, car accident injuries aren’t obvious right away, and they can get worse if they don’t get treated right away. Any of these injuries can happen without you knowing it:

  • Whiplash, concussions, and brain blood clots are all head and neck injuries
  • Muscle, nerve, or ligament damage in the back
  • Bleeding inside
  • Injuries to the spinal column
  • Bruises
  • Having a traumatic brain injury
  • Orthopedic Doctors

An orthopedic car accident doctor specializes in orthopedic medicine and is a specialist in auto accidents. Muscles, joints, spines, soft tissues, and tendons are among the injuries that they treat. 

  • In addition to this particular specialty, they are also suitable medical doctors in the event that you sustain injuries as a result of a car accident.
  • Auto accidents typically cause injuries to the spine or neck of the injured individual, as well as to muscles and tissues as a result of the crash impact. 
  • Because orthopedic doctors are experts in treating injuries caused by car accidents, they will approach treatment more comprehensively.
  • The doctors often use specialized equipment to diagnose injuries and can even determine injuries that are not immediately apparent following an accident.
  •  During your recovery process, an orthopedic doctor will determine the best course of treatment for your injury and provide you with the necessary medical care.
  • Emergency Room Doctors

Depending on the severity of the injury sustained in a car accident, emergency medicine may be required. 

  • Upon arriving at the hospital, the injured person is taken to the emergency room (ER), where they are stabilized by an ER physician.
  • The emergency room doctor provides emergency medicine to patients with acute or life-threatening injuries. 
  • Their main focus is stabilizing patients and providing differential diagnoses so that other specialists can take care of them. 
  • Trauma Surgeons

Emergency surgery is performed by trauma surgeons. An experienced trauma surgeon is qualified to perform surgery on a car accident survivor who has suffered critical injuries.

  • Injuries resulting from auto accidents may occur in the form of severe burns, including thermal burns and chemical burns.A forceful impact may also result in blunt or penetrating trauma. Trauma surgeons are always available to treat your following conditions.
  • Following the immediate treatment of your emergency condition, it is not uncommon for a trauma surgeon to continue to monitor your progress as you recover from your injury. 
  • Additionally, he refers you to a different doctor or surgeon.
  • Primary Care Doctors

Physicians or primary care physicians treat a variety of illnesses and injuries. The physicians are qualified medical professionals who are trained to diagnose, prevent, and treat a wide variety of illnesses and injuries, including those resulting from car accidents.

  • Primary care physicians often refer patients to the appropriate specialists following diagnosis and follow up on their treatment.
